Some travel agents also charge a nominal consultation fee for each booking, typically …Jan 25, 2024 · How do travel agent commissions work? A supplier — hotels, rental car agencies and so on — pays a travel agent commission for making a reservation on behalf of a client (or group of clients; here’s why group bookings are great ). The amount is typically a percentage of whatever the service costs, and can vary widely depending on the type ... They may also concentrate in a special ...Go to Hilton's travel agent site and click "Special Rates" then select the "Travel Agents" option. Beyond travel agent rates, Hilton is also part of the Unlimited Rewards program which offers .50¢ to $2.00 per night stay you book for your clients.
